Trial transcripts can be applied for, which are records of what both parties said during the trial. After signing, you can inquire with the Clerk.
Normally, there's a process: a written application is required, and usually, you can't get it on the spot during the trial because it needs the signatures and confirmation of both parties and the presiding personnel.
So normally, you first sign the application form, and then you might have to pay some money. This money is for binding and printing fees; the Clerk needs to bind it for you.
If you forget to apply during the trial, you can still apply to retrieve it later, which is allowed. If the other party doesn't give it to you, it's either because they don't want the hassle or they're doing it on purpose.
If they don't give it to you, there's absolutely no problem with complaining; don't be afraid.
